To make a car’s interior look brand-new, all the surfaces need to be deep cleaned and protected. The plastics can be cleaned using an all-purpose cleaner, leather can be cleaned using a dedicated leather cleaner and fabric seats, carpets and mats should be cleaned using a wet vac.

Web9 apr. 2024 · To create a chipping effect, use a light color that corresponds to your model and dab the chipping shapes. Do not paint them as such because it will look overdone. Use a stippling effect to do this. With a darker color, dab the interior areas of the lighter color to give the effects full potential.
